Enter the Unsung Hero: Non-Slip Helpers

First up, the classic: a damp towel. Yes, that's right. The same towel you use to wipe flour off your counter can become your cake's best friend.

Just dampen it (not soaking wet, mind you!), wring it out well, and place it under your turntable. It creates a grippy surface that says, "You shall not pass...or slide!".

It is a humble, yet effective solution that will prevent your cake's unwanted journey.

Next, consider the magic of a non-slip mat. Those rubbery wonders aren't just for keeping rugs in place! Cut a piece to fit your turntable and voila! Cake-sliding crisis averted.

These mats offer a superior grip, making them perfect for even the most ambitious cake decorating projects.

Think of it as a tiny, invisible superhero saving your cake from a tumble. There are numerous brands of these mats, and they are also available at most hardware stores.

Another fantastic option is double-sided tape. It is a trusty adhesive companion in the baker's arsenal.

A few strategically placed strips of double-sided tape can work wonders to keep that board in place.

The Buttercream Bridge: A Sticky Situation (Solved!)

Sometimes, the solution is as simple as using what you already have: buttercream! A small dollop of buttercream frosting beneath the cake board can act like a tiny glue.

It's a sweet and effective way to anchor your cake. Plus, who doesn't love a little extra buttercream?

Just remember to use a relatively thick consistency buttercream. A runny buttercream will make the matter worse.

However, be aware that it will not work with all frostings. For example, cream cheese frosting will not create a firm grip.

Beyond the Board: Other Slippery Situations

The sliding cake board isn't the only potential slippery slope in the baking world. Sometimes, it's the decorations themselves that cause trouble.

Heavy fondant decorations, for example, can sometimes weigh down one side of the cake, causing it to tilt or slide. Balance is key!

Think of it like building a miniature skyscraper: you need a solid foundation and even weight distribution.

Similarly, tall cakes can be prone to wobbling. Consider using cake dowels for extra support, especially if you're transporting the cake.

Cake dowels are like tiny internal scaffolding that keeps your cake upright and prevents it from collapsing under its own weight.

They are also a great method to prevent the cake from sliding on the cake board.

And remember, temperature plays a role too. A warm cake is a soft cake, and a soft cake is more likely to slide. Keep your cake chilled for maximum stability.

Cool temperatures help solidify the frosting and make the cake less prone to shifting during decorating or transport.
